  1. A vacation spent in a place with a colder climate to avoid unpleasantly hot weather. informal
    — For the vast majority of folks, summer holidays used to be about following the sun, seeking the heat—watching the mercury climb and hitting the sands. With the intense, record-breaking temperatures of recent years, however, many are considering traveling in the opposite direction: booking "coolcations" in temperate destinations, which also benefit from being less crowded.

词源

Blend of cool + vacation.
